ANN ARBOR, Mich. – The Western Michigan women's tennis team wrapped up the Wolverine Invitational at the University of Michigan on Sunday.
The Broncos picked up one win coming in doubles play. Kiana Rizzolo and Ana Guadiana defeated Michigan's Jaedan Brown and Andrea Cerdan 6-4. In singles play both Lindsey Zieglar and Guadiana dropped three-set singles matches.
"Overall we had a great weekend of tennis," said head coach Ryan Tomlinson. "Congrats to Elizabeth on winning her flight in singles and Taylor and Kristina in winning their flights in doubles at the Eagles Invitational. We battled against great competition and competed at a high level. We look forward to working on some things in preparation for our last fall tournament in November."
The Broncos have a month off before hosting the Bronco Super Challenge Nov. 12-14 at West Hills Athletic Club.
